Effective Communication and Documentation

Establishing Clear Lines of Contact

Maintaining clear and regular communication is essential. Stay in constant touch with your solicitor and estate agent. Weekly updates via phone or email can help you stay informed. Ask your conveyancer for any news immediately. If you face a problem, prompt communication helps resolve it quickly. Clear instructions to all parties involved prevent misunderstandings and delays.

Ensure your contact information is up-to-date and all parties have it. This includes phone numbers and email addresses. Communication is crucial when dealing with leasehold properties where more paperwork and approvals are needed.

Timely Submission and Review of Paperwork

Timely paperwork submission is vital. Gather your documents early, including ID, proof of address, and the Property Information Form. Submit these during the initial stages to avoid delays.

Arrange surveys promptly and flag any issues for the surveyor to inspect. Speak to your surveyors and conveyancers about findings to avoid further delays.

Review all documents as soon as you receive them. This includes contracts, transfer deeds, and any leasehold agreements. Ensure there are no errors and discuss any concerns with your solicitor.

Keeping a checklist of required documents and deadlines helps you stay organised. Prompt responses and thorough reviews ensure progress without hold-ups.

Streamlining the Conveyancing Stage

Conducting Efficient Searches and Surveys

To speed up the conveyancing process, arrange your survey promptly. Notify your surveyor of any specific concerns such as structural integrity or potential renovations. This ensures the survey targets critical areas, preventing delays later.

Efficient handling of searches is also vital. Local authority searches, drainage searches, and environmental searches can take time. Initiate these searches as soon as possible. Prior communication with your conveyancer can help anticipate any time-sensitive issues or required documents, such as FENSA certificates or records of past alterations, that may arise during the property transaction.

Survey reports often include valuation details which are crucial in finalising the mortgage process. Ensure you promptly share the survey report with both your conveyancer and your mortgage lender to avoid unnecessary delays.

Handling Specific Property Types and Issues

Different property types require different considerations. If purchasing a leasehold property, check the lease terms and obtain the management information pack early. For a new build property, verify if the builder provides the necessary completion certificates.

Identifying potential issues early is essential. Look for any history of alterations and ensure all certifications, like gas safety or FENSA certificates, are up to date. This goes a long way in avoiding delays.

Buying or Selling at Auction

Traditional Method of Auction

One effective way to speed up your property transaction is to buy or sell at auction. Under the Traditional Method of auction, the buyer and seller exchange contracts immediately and then have 28 days to complete the sale. This method is often quicker than standard property transactions, making it an attractive option for those looking to expedite the process.

Modern Method of Auction

With the Modern Method of auction, the buyer pays a non-refundable reservation fee when their bid is accepted. Both parties then have 56 days to exchange contracts and complete the sale. Although this is longer than the traditional method, it is still much quicker than most standard property transactions.

Advantages of Auction Transactions

  • Speed: Auctions can significantly reduce the time it takes to complete a property transaction.
  • Certainty: Once the hammer falls, the sale is legally binding, reducing the risk of the deal falling through.
  • Transparency: The auction process is open and transparent, providing a clear understanding of the sale terms.

Handling Issues Arising from Property Surveys

Common Survey Issues and Solutions

When purchasing a property, surveys can reveal unexpected issues. Common problems include structural damage, damp, and outdated electrical systems. Addressing these issues promptly is crucial to avoid delays. For instance, if a survey uncovers structural damage, consult a structural engineer immediately to assess the extent of the damage and obtain repair estimates.

Communicating with Surveyors and Solicitors

Effective communication with your surveyor and solicitor is essential. Ensure that any issues identified in the survey are clearly communicated to your solicitor. This allows for a swift resolution and prevents delays in the transaction process. Regular updates and prompt responses can significantly speed up the process.

Ensuring Compliance with Local Regulations

Understanding Local Authority Searches

Local authority searches are essential in any property transaction. These searches provide critical information about the property, such as planning permissions, building regulations, and any potential restrictions. Initiating these searches early can prevent delays later in the process. For instance, if you’re buying a family villa with a private pool, knowing about any local restrictions on pool installations is crucial.

Importance of Environmental and Drainage Searches

Environmental and drainage searches help identify any environmental risks or drainage issues that could affect the property. These searches can reveal problems like flood risks, contaminated land, or poor drainage systems. Addressing these issues early ensures that you are fully aware of any potential problems and can negotiate accordingly.

Other Essential Searches and Their Impact

Other essential searches include checking for any local infrastructure projects that might impact the property, such as new roads or public transport links. These searches can also uncover any historical issues with the property, such as previous subsidence or structural problems. By conducting thorough searches, you can make an informed decision and avoid unexpected surprises later on.
